Postmessaje

ContentWindow Postmessage

ContentWindow Postmessage
  1. ¿Qué hace el postmesaje de la ventana??
  2. ¿Es seguro usar el postmessaje de la ventana??
  3. ¿Cuál es la diferencia entre SendMessage y PostMessage??
  4. ¿Qué es la vulnerabilidad posterior a la presentación??
  5. Es postmessage asincrónico?
  6. ¿Cómo se comunica entre dos iframes??
  7. ¿Qué es la API de postmessage??
  8. ¿Funciona el postmessage el dominio cruzado??
  9. ¿Qué es Window OnMessage??
  10. ¿Cómo uso el postmessaje de la ventana en React??
  11. ¿Qué es la mensajería posterior??
  12. ¿Qué significa el mensaje de publicación??
  13. ¿Cómo se comunica entre dos iframes??
  14. ¿Qué es TargetOrigin en el postmessage??
  15. Cómo enviar el mensaje de los padres a iframe?

¿Qué hace el postmesaje de la ventana??

La ventana. El método postmessage () permite de forma segura la comunicación de origen cruzado entre los objetos de la ventana; mi.gramo., entre una página y una ventana emergente que generó, o entre una página y un iframe incrustado dentro de ella.

¿Es seguro usar el postmessaje de la ventana??

El postmessage generalmente se considera muy seguro siempre que el programador tenga cuidado de verificar el origen y la fuente de un mensaje que llega. Actuar en un mensaje sin verificar su fuente abre un vector para ataques de secuencia de comandos de sitios cruzados.

¿Cuál es la diferencia entre SendMessage y PostMessage??

SendMessage: envía un mensaje y espera hasta que el procedimiento que sea responsable del mensaje finaliza y devuelve. PostMessage: envía un mensaje a la cola de mensajes y devuelve inmediatamente. Pero no sabes cuándo se está procesando ese mensaje.

¿Qué es la vulnerabilidad posterior a la presentación??

XS basado en DOM usando PostMessage inseguro ():

Una vulnerabilidad de secuencias de comandos de sitios cruzados (XSS) basados ​​en DOM ocurre cuando la carga útil de un evento de mensaje se maneja de manera insegura. La siguiente tabla enumera algunas de las funciones y atributos más comunes que pueden conducir a una vulnerabilidad XSS.

Es postmessage asincrónico?

La función postmessage () es asíncrona, lo que significa que volverá inmediatamente. Para que no puedas hacer una comunicación sincrónica con ella. En su ejemplo, el mensaje publicado desaparecerá en el vacío, porque no hay oyente para el evento de mensaje en el momento en que se ejecuta la función postmessage ().

¿Cómo se comunica entre dos iframes??

Comunicar directamente entre iframes también es posible combinando ventana. padre con objetivo como se define anteriormente. En conclusión, el método posterior a la medición es una alternativa más dinámica al DOM único, más adecuado si carga varias páginas en un iframe, pero no siempre es más fácil y aún requiere el uso del DOM.

¿Qué es la API de postmessage??

La API posterior a la Message se usa para interactuar con el marco principal cuando la parte del navegador de Collabora Online está encerrada en uno. Esto es útil para los anfitriones que desean integrar colaboración en línea en ellos. Esta API se basa principalmente en la especificación WOPI con pocas extensiones/modificaciones.

¿Funciona el postmessage el dominio cruzado??

PostMessage () es un método global que permite la comunicación de origen cruzado de forma segura. Se parece mucho a Ajax pero con capacidad de dominio cruzado. Le daremos un torbellino configurando la comunicación bidireccional entre una página web y un iframe cuyo contenido reside en otro servidor.

¿Qué es Window OnMessage??

El evento OnMessage ocurre cuando se recibe un mensaje a través de una fuente de evento. El objeto de evento para el evento OnMessage admite las siguientes propiedades: Datos: contiene el mensaje real.

¿Cómo uso el postmessaje de la ventana en React??

importar reaccionar de 'reaccionar'; import iconButton de '@material-ui/core'; importar fotocamera de '@material-ui/icons/Photocamera'; importar './Aplicación. CSS '; function app () const send = () => if (ventana && ventana. Padre) Consola. Log ('Tenemos mensajes enviando aquí', ventana.

¿Qué es la mensajería posterior??

PostMessage () es una forma segura de enviar mensajes entre ventanas en diferentes dominios o orígenes. También se puede publicar en un iframe. Los datos que se envían se serializan utilizando el algoritmo de clon estructurado y aceptarán casi cualquier tipo de datos simples o complejos.

¿Qué significa el mensaje de publicación??

Publicar un mensaje significa transferir, enviar, publicar, publicar, difundir o comunicarse de otra manera, o intentar transferir, enviar, publicar, publicar, difundir o comunicarse de otra manera, cualquier mensaje o información, ya sea veraz o falso, sobre un individuo, y si se hace bajo el propio nombre, debajo ...

¿Cómo se comunica entre dos iframes??

Comunicar directamente entre iframes también es posible combinando ventana. padre con objetivo como se define anteriormente. En conclusión, el método posterior a la medición es una alternativa más dinámica al DOM único, más adecuado si carga varias páginas en un iframe, pero no siempre es más fácil y aún requiere el uso del DOM.

¿Qué es TargetOrigin en el postmessage??

marcos, etc. Mensaje: datos que se enviarán. TargetOrigin: el origen de la ventana objetivo que se supone que recibirá el mensaje. Si el origen de TargetWindow no coincide con el TargetOrigin especificado aquí, el mensaje no se enviará en absoluto. Esto agrega una capa de seguridad a la funcionalidad postmessage ().

Cómo enviar el mensaje de los padres a iframe?

Enviar algunos datos del niño iframe a la ventana principal también es bastante simple. Siempre que incruste un iframe, el iframe tendrá una referencia a la ventana principal. Solo necesita usar la API posterior a la Message para enviar datos a través de la ventana. Referencia de los padres de la ventana principal.

Ejecutando 2 clientes al mismo tiempo y se atasca al 95% Circuit_Create Establecer un circuito TOR después de un par de minutos
¿Cómo se configura un circuito TOR??¿Por qué es tan lento??¿Por qué no están cargando mis páginas??¿Cómo se revisas un circuito TOR??¿Cómo funciona u...
¿Cómo resuelvo el problema de arranque de Tor con frambuesa?
¿Cómo arreglo el navegador Tor??¿Por qué Tor Browser no está estableciendo la conexión??¿Puede Raspberry Pi ejecutar tor?¿Pueden los rusos acceder a ...
Verificación de autosuficiencia para el servicio oculto
¿Qué es un servicio oculto??¿Qué es el protocolo de servicio oculto??¿Cómo funciona un servicio oculto??¿Cómo encuentro servicios ocultos en Windows?...